Go ORM Helper 插件使用教程
1. 项目目录结构及介绍
go-orm-helper/
├── assets/
├── example/
├── gradle/
├── src/
│ └── main/
├── .gitignore
├── CHANGELOG.md
├── DESCRIPTION.md
├── LICENSE
├── README-ja_JP.md
├── README-ko_KR.md
├── README-zh_CN.md
├── README.md
├── SUPPORTED.md
├── build.gradle.kts
├── gradle.properties
├── gradlew
├── gradlew.bat
├── qodana.yml
└── settings.gradle.kts
目录结构说明
- assets/: 存放项目资源文件。
- example/: 存放示例代码。
- gradle/: 存放Gradle构建脚本。
- src/main/: 存放项目源代码。
- .gitignore: Git忽略文件配置。
- CHANGELOG.md: 项目更新日志。
- DESCRIPTION.md: 项目描述文件。
- LICENSE: 项目许可证文件。
- README-ja_JP.md: 日文版README文件。
- README-ko_KR.md: 韩文版README文件。
- README-zh_CN.md: 中文版README文件。
- README.md: 英文版README文件。
- SUPPORTED.md: 支持的ORM框架列表。
- build.gradle.kts: Gradle构建脚本。
- gradle.properties: Gradle属性配置文件。
- gradlew: Gradle包装器脚本。
- gradlew.bat: Gradle包装器批处理脚本。
- qodana.yml: Qodana静态代码分析配置文件。
- settings.gradle.kts: Gradle设置脚本。
2. 项目的启动文件介绍
Go ORM Helper 插件没有传统的启动文件,因为它是一个IDE插件,主要功能是通过IDE的插件系统来提供数据库字段自动补全、Tag生成和Struct生成等功能。
3. 项目的配置文件介绍
3.1 gradle.properties
该文件用于配置Gradle构建工具的属性,例如:
# Gradle properties
org.gradle.jvmargs=-Xmx2048m -Dfile.encoding=UTF-8
org.gradle.parallel=true
3.2 settings.gradle.kts
该文件用于配置Gradle项目的设置,例如:
rootProject.name = "go-orm-helper"
3.3 qodana.yml
该文件用于配置Qodana静态代码分析工具的设置,例如:
version: 2023.2
profile:
name: Default
path: qodana.profile.xml
通过以上配置文件,可以对项目的构建和静态代码分析进行详细的设置。